H.R. 9260 (93rd)
A bill to provide that the Administrator of the Social and Economic Statistics Administration, Department of Commerce, be subject to Senate confirmation, and for other purposes.

Summary
Provides that the Administrator of the Social and Economic Statistics Administration, Department of Commerce, shall be subject to Senate confirmation. (Amends 5 U.S.C. 5315)
